Easy Steps to Grow Your Aloe Vera Plant From Scratch

Growing your own aloe vera plant from scratch may seem like a challenge, but it's actually pretty straightforward. You just need to follow a few basic steps to succeed in this exciting project. First, make sure you get a good quality aloe vera plant. You can buy it at a local nursery or even order one online. Then, choose a suitable pot with good drainage to prevent root rot. Be sure to fill the pot with a special mix of cactus and succulent soil, as these plants require well-drained soil. After planting your aloe vera, place it in a sunny spot where it can receive at least six hours of direct light a day. Don't forget to water it moderately every two weeks, preventing water from pooling at the base of the plant. Aloe vera is hardy and doesn't need a lot of water to survive. Finally, remember to prune the mature leaves to keep your plant healthy and encourage the growth of new leaves. Tips for proper aloe vera care at home

Proper aloe vera care at home is key to ensuring that this plant can thrive and provide you with all of its benefits. Here are some practical tips to keep your aloe vera plant happy and healthy. First of all, it's important to provide it with the right amount of sunlight. Aloe vera loves light, but you should avoid exposing it directly to the sun for long periods, as this can burn its leaves. Place it near a sunny window, but make sure there's some shade during the heaviest hours of the day. When it comes to watering, remember that aloe vera is a succulent plant and doesn't require a lot of water. You should water it only when the soil is completely dry, which is usually every two to three weeks. Avoid overwatering, as this can rot the roots and damage the plant. Also, make sure to use a pot with good drainage to allow water to flow properly. Finally, keep in mind that aloe vera also needs well-drained and light soil. You can mix potting soil with sand or perlite to improve water circulation. Common Myths About Growing and caring for Aloe Vera

When it comes to growing and caring for aloe vera, there are many common myths that can confuse beginners. One of the most popular myths is that aloe vera requires a lot of water to grow properly. However, this is not true. Aloe vera is a succulent plant that stores water in its leaves, making it able to survive in drought conditions. Overwatering can be harmful and lead to the development of fungal diseases in the roots. Another common myth is that aloe vera needs direct sunlight throughout the day. While this plant prefers bright light, too much sun exposure can burn its sensitive leaves. It's best to place it in a spot with indirect light or semi-shade. Also, some believe that all varieties of aloe vera are the same in terms of care, but this is not true. Each species has different watering, light, and temperature needs, so it's important to do your research on the specific variety you have before you start growing it.
